  Explains in a nontechnical manner how to conduct follow-up studies of individuals with special needs or disabilities. The individual chapters take the reader through the step-by-step process of designing and carrying out a follow-up study. Includes information about deciding what one wants to know about the individuals to be surveyed and describes how to put the collected data to work for the school system. School to work transition--evaluation--methodology. From the Transition Series.
